The struggles continue for the Toronto Blue Jays. Masahiro Tanaka pitched seven solid innings as the New York Yankees doubled up Toronto 6-3, handing the Jays their fifth straight loss and ninth in 11 games. Toronto starter Marcus Stroman had to leave the game after five innings with a blister on his right ring finger.
A two-run single in the 11th inning and the Boston Red Sox beat the Texas Rangers 7-5 for their A-L-best fifth straight victory. Boston needed extra innings after Mike Napoli led off the Rangers’ ninth with a homer off Craig Kimbrel.
Alexander Radulov is getting a hefty raise. The former Canadiens left-winger signed a five-year deal with the Dallas Stars worth $31.25-million dollars. It’s the most lucrative deal offered to an unrestricted free agent so far this off-season. And Montreal signed Ales Hemsky to a one-year, one-million dollar contract to help fill the void left by Radulov’s departure.
Eugenie Bouchard had a rough start to her Wimbledon tournament. The 23-year-old from Westmount, Quebec lost her first-round match to Spain’s Carla Suarez Navarro. Earlier in the day, Montreal’s Francoise Abanda won her first-round match but wild-card entry Denis Shapovalov of Richmond Hill, Ontario lost his.
